COVID-19 Response: Vecna is committed to delivering safe, streamlined patient intake – throughout the pandemic and beyond. Learn more

Better Technology. Better World.

That’s our motto and we’re stickin’ to it! Give us a shout to find out how we can be better together.

Fill out the form to send us an email. Or, call us to talk to a human immediately.

Customer Support

Healthcare never sleeps. Neither do we. Contact us any time.


Phone: (855) 458-8267


If you are calling from a Veterans Administration facility, please call us at (855) 460-8267.


One Burlington Woods Dr. 
Suite 201 
Burlington, MA 01803


(617) 864-0636


(617) 864-0638